What is a political associate?

Political Associates are professionals who support political campaigns, organizations, or advocacy groups by assisting with research, communications, event planning, and strategic initiatives. They often help coordinate outreach efforts, manage relationships with stakeholders, and track policy developments relevant to their organization. Political Associates may also assist with data analysis, preparing reports, and supporting senior political staff in daily operations. This role requires strong organizational and communication skills, as well as a keen interest in politics and public policy.

What are some common challenges political associates face when supporting campaign activities?

Political Associates often handle fast-paced and unpredictable workloads, especially during election cycles. They may face challenges such as rapidly shifting priorities, tight deadlines, and coordinating with multiple stakeholders, including volunteers, campaign managers, and external partners. Adaptability, strong communication skills, and attention to detail are crucial in managing these demands effectively while ensuring campaign goals are met. Additionally, balancing administrative duties with strategic tasks can be demanding, but it provides valuable exposure to the broader workings of political campaigns.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a political associ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Political Associate, you need a solid understanding of political science, policy analysis, and campaign strategies, often supported by a bachelor’s degree in political science or a related field. Familiarity with data analysis tools, social media platforms, and constituent management systems such as NGP VAN is typically required. Strong written and verbal communication, interpersonal skills, and the ability to work under pressure make candidates stand out in this role. These skills are essential for effectively supporting campaigns, building stakeholder relationships, and managing fast-paced political projects.

What is the difference between Political Associate vs Campaign Coordinator?

AspectPolitical AssociateCampaign Coordinator
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ree in political science, communications, or related fieldBachelor's degree; experience in campaign operations preferred
Work EnvironmentOffice-based, supporting political campaigns or organizationsField and office work during campaign seasons
Employer & IndustryPolitical parties, advocacy groups, government officesPolitical campaigns, nonprofit organizations
Common Search/ComparisonPolitical Associate vs Campaign Coordinator

The main difference is that a Political Associate typically focuses on research, policy analysis, and supporting campaign strategies, while a Campaign Coordinator manages day-to-day campaign operations and logistics. Both roles require similar educational backgrounds and work in political environments, but their responsibilities and focus areas differ.
